I hope this email finds you in the GREEN zone...calm, focused and relaxed. As promised, I wanted to share some visuals and tools for the next step on the Road to Regulation. For example, if you find yourself in the BLUE zone (sleepy, bored, etc.) you may need to stretch or do some jumping jacks to wake up your brain and body. A brisk walk outside in the sun can do wonders! If you are in the YELLOW zone (anxious, silly, etc.) maybe some deep breaths or yoga may do the trick. RED zone (angry, out of control, etc.) means you may have to take a run, brisk walk or do heavy work to tap into that extra energy or perhaps journaling or listening to music would help.
Reminder, there are NO BAD ZONES. According to Emily LaShorne Walz, Implementation Specialist at The Zones of Regulation - "The goal of the Zones of Regulation is to emphasize that when we are dysregulated, we don’t need to change Zones, we need to regulate within, manage, or take care of our Zone. This allows us to honor our authentic feelings while meeting the demands of the environment around us, helping us to accomplish our goals, and supporting our well-being."
Consider using some of these phrases with your child:
- “Let’s use a tool to take care of our Zones.”
- “I wonder if a tool might help us manage our Zones right now?”
- “I need a tool to regulate my Zone, how about you?”
- “What Zone are you in? Is there a tool that might help?”
